Output dffbaec18d504decdbc8293c5359ff005b2ad1f4c0d3e82d1e1e62623136d82f:23

value
113073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66997db73652a5dd7c31e5d7b5ef11c50b4ed2a3 OP_EQUAL
address
3B3Wirggn259xoJUiZjXASAxGh1JaBkHQa
transaction
dffbaec18d504decdbc8293c5359ff005b2ad1f4c0d3e82d1e1e62623136d82f
confirmations
102440
spent
true